Clients can expect a professional experience that is tailored to their needs. I will always check your pelvic alignment because I find it can influence pain. I may want to do some manual stretching with you where you relax and I do the work. I may ask you to wear or bring some shorts and a tee shirts for the manual stretching. I will utilize a gentle form of myofascial release from John Barnes, PT appropriate for licensed massage therapists and combine this with therapeutic massage for your session.
You can be assured that the session will not be painful, eventhough I will address your areas of pain. It will also be relaxing in a stress free environment.
- For your appointment please shower beforehand and do not have any lotion, perfume or cologne on your skin.Please wear or bring some shorts that are loose fitting in the legs and comfortable at the waist.
- For the Massage portion you can undress to your comfort level and I will drape (cover) you with a sheet.
What kind of conditions can I work with?
- Pain and stiffness, never having surgery
- Pain before or after surgery
- Back spasms
- Neck surgeries including fusions and artifical disc replacemnts
- Back surgeries including fusions, 360's, artificial disc replacements, laminectomies, discectomies, etc.
- Adult women and men with Scoliosis
- Knee, hip and shoulder problems and replacements
- SI Joint pain and stiffness
- EDS, Rheumatoid Arthritis, Fibromyalgia, Osteoporosis and other conditions
- People who have had cancer including breast cancer, colon and prostate cancer
- People who need pain relief and a relaxing massage!
- People who have stiffness, tightness or injuries from sports including Pickleball and running.
